Loading
Loading
Loading
Loading
Loading
Loading
Loading
Loading
Loading
Back Low Code Development

Low-Code for Legacy System Modernization: A Practical Guide for 2026

Informat Team· 2026-06-02 00:00· 27.0K views
Low-Code for Legacy System Modernization: A Practical Guide for 2026

Low-Code for Legacy System Modernization: A Practical Guide for 2026

Legacy system modernization has historically been one of the most expensive, risky, and time-consuming undertakings in enterprise IT. Mainframe applications running COBOL, client-server systems built in the 1990s, and sprawling Excel-and-email-based processes that have grown organically over decades represent billions of dollars in technical debt. In 2026, low-code platforms have emerged as a pragmatic modernization strategy that offers a middle path between the high-risk "rip and replace" approach and the unsustainable "maintain forever" approach.

This article provides a practical guide to using low-code platforms for legacy system modernization, covering the strategies, patterns, and real-world considerations that determine success.

The Legacy Modernization Challenge

To understand why low-code has become an attractive modernization approach, it helps to understand the limitations of traditional modernization strategies. The "big bang rewrite" — replacing a legacy system with a custom-built modern equivalent — is the most ambitious approach and the most likely to fail. Industry data shows that large-scale custom rewrite projects fail at rates exceeding 50%, with the failures often becoming apparent only after tens or hundreds of millions of dollars have been spent.

The "commercial off-the-shelf replacement" — buying a modern packaged application to replace the legacy system — avoids the custom development risk but introduces its own challenges. Enterprise packages rarely fit the organization's unique processes perfectly, leading to expensive customization, painful business process reengineering, or both. The "maintain and wrap" approach — keeping the legacy system running while building API layers around it — is the least risky in the short term but does nothing to address the underlying technical debt, increasing maintenance costs, and growing skills shortage for legacy technologies.

Low-code modernization offers a fourth path: incrementally replacing legacy functionality with modern, low-code-built applications, often integrated with the remaining legacy system through APIs, while maintaining business continuity throughout the transition. This approach reduces risk through incremental delivery, lowers cost through faster development, and addresses the skills challenge by enabling a broader pool of developers — including business domain experts — to participate in the modernization effort.

Low-Code Modernization Patterns

Several patterns have emerged from organizations that have successfully used low-code platforms for legacy modernization. Each pattern addresses a different modernization scenario, and large modernization programs typically employ multiple patterns in combination.

The Strangler Fig Pattern

Named after the fig tree that gradually envelops and replaces its host, this pattern involves building new functionality around the edges of the legacy system — new user interfaces, new workflows, new integrations — using low-code, while the legacy system continues to operate as the backend. Over time, more and more functionality is migrated to the low-code layer until the legacy system can be retired or reduced to a pure data store. This pattern minimizes risk because each increment is small and independently reversible, and the legacy system remains operational as a safety net throughout the transition.

The Process Extraction Pattern

Many legacy systems are monolithic not just in technology but in process — a single mainframe application might handle order entry, inventory management, invoicing, and reporting in one tightly coupled codebase. The process extraction pattern identifies individual business processes within the monolith and extracts them into separate low-code applications, one process at a time. The extracted processes communicate with the remaining monolith through APIs. Over time, the monolith shrinks as processes are extracted, until only the core data and the most complex business rules remain — at which point they can be addressed with a targeted effort.

The Front-End Modernization Pattern

When the legacy system's core business logic is sound but its user interface is archaic — green screens, terminal emulators, complex keystroke commands — low-code can provide a modern, web-based user interface that interacts with the legacy backend through APIs or screen scraping. This pattern delivers rapid user experience improvement without touching the legacy business logic, buying time for a more thorough modernization while immediately improving productivity and reducing training requirements for new employees.

Real-World Low-Code Modernization in Action

A global insurance company faced a common modernization challenge: a 30-year-old claims processing system running on a mainframe, maintained by a shrinking pool of COBOL developers, and costing millions annually in maintenance alone. A full rewrite was estimated at three years and $40 million, with significant execution risk. Instead, the company adopted a strangler fig approach using a low-code platform. They began by building a modern claims intake application — customer-facing web forms, document upload, and initial triage — that fed data into the legacy system through APIs. Next, they extracted the claims adjudication process for simple, high-volume claims into a low-code workflow with AI-assisted decision-making. Then they extracted reporting and analytics into a low-code dashboard pulling data from both the legacy system and the new applications. After 18 months, 60% of claims volume was being processed entirely in the low-code environment. The legacy system was reduced to handling complex, low-volume claims and serving as the historical data repository. Total cost was $12 million — less than a third of the rewrite estimate — and the incremental approach meant the company never experienced a "cutover weekend" of existential risk.

Key Success Factors for Low-Code Modernization

Experience from organizations that have navigated low-code modernization reveals several factors that consistently distinguish successful programs from those that struggle. A deep understanding of the legacy system is essential — not just the technology, but the business processes it supports and the edge cases it handles. Low-code modernization teams must include people who understand both the legacy system and the business domain; without this knowledge, critical business rules embedded in the legacy code will be missed until they cause production failures.

A robust integration layer is critical. Low-code modernization depends on the ability to integrate with the legacy system during the transition period. Organizations that have invested in API layers, integration platforms, or legacy system wrappers before beginning low-code modernization have dramatically smoother experiences than those that try to build integrations on the fly. An incremental delivery cadence with business value delivered every few months maintains stakeholder support and funding through what is invariably a multi-year journey. And a clear end-state vision, even if the path to reach it evolves, ensures that each incremental step moves the organization toward a coherent target architecture rather than creating a new generation of fragmented systems.

When Low-Code Modernization Is — And Is Not — the Right Approach

Low-code modernization is well-suited to legacy systems where the business logic is well-understood and documented, the system supports discrete business processes that can be modernized independently, the existing user interface is a significant pain point, and the organization has strong domain expertise but limited modern development capacity.

It is less suitable for systems with extremely high transaction volumes or stringent performance requirements that push the limits of low-code platform capabilities, systems where the business logic is poorly understood — encoded in decades of undocumented code changes — and nobody truly knows everything the system does, and systems that are close to end-of-life where the modernization investment cannot be justified by the remaining useful life of the processes the system supports. In these cases, alternative strategies — targeted rewrite of the most critical components, commercial package replacement, or managed decline — may be more appropriate.

Conclusion: Pragmatic Modernization at Scale

Low-code platforms have changed the economics of legacy modernization. The incremental, low-risk patterns they enable — combined with the speed and accessibility of low-code development — make modernization feasible for systems and organizations where a full rewrite was never a realistic option. The key is not to treat low-code as a magic solution — legacy modernization is inherently complex, and no platform eliminates that complexity — but to use it as a pragmatic tool that reduces the cost, risk, and time required to bring legacy systems into the modern era.

Start building

Ready to build your enterprise system?

Use AI to design, generate, and operate the system your team actually needs.